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will use specialized equipment to extract water and dry your property. We’ll work quickly and efficiently to reduce further damage and prevent mold growth. We’ll use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to remove standing water and we’ll use dehumidifiers and air movers to dry your property. We’ll also use antimicrobial treatments to prevent mold and bacteria growth.

Category 1 Water Damage Cleanup Cost in Olympia, SC
The cost of Category 1 water damage cleanup can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Olympia, SC. These estimates are based on industry averages and may not reflect your specific situation. We’ll provide a detailed estimate after our initial assessment. We’ll work with your insurance company to ensure a seamless claims process.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Antimicrobial treatments |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of antimicrobial treatment |
| Dehumidification and air movement |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Water damage cleanup and rest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and scope of work |
| Documentation and claims support | $500 – $2,000 | Complexity of claims process, number of documents required, and insurance company cooperation |
